Brandon Rusnak (born Brandon Watson on July 11, 1995) is an American football cornerback for the Arlington Renegades of the United Football League (UFL).
He played college football for University of Michigan.

Rusnak signed with the Jacksonville Jaguars as an undrafted free agent. He was later signed to the practice squad before being promoted to the active roster.
On August 31, 2021, Rusnak was waived by the Jaguars and re-signed to the practice squad the next day. He was promoted to the active roster on December 28.
On August 29, 2022, Rusnak was waived by the Jaguars.
Rusnak signed with the Arlington Renegades of the XFL on March 7, 2023. He re-signed with the team on January 22, 2024.
Rusnak was born Brandon Watson, but legally changed his name to Brandon Rusnak in November 2020.
